Thailand - Re-Import of Soya Beans
With $28,231.5 in 2016, the country was ranked number 7 comparing other countries in Re-Import of Soya Beans. Thailand is overtaken by South Africa, which was number 6 at $45,007.06 and is followed by Slovakia with $10,674.82. China ranked the highest with $387,028 in 2018, that is +130.9% versus 2017. Australia, Argentina and Moldova resp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Argentina recorded the best 5 years average growth at +175.9% per year, while France witnessed the worst performance at -38.9% per year.
